I have created a custom FPM application using the Self Service Administrator Role for usability in MSS. Every thing now looks good in the Development portal and I would like transport the FPM application to other portals (test and prod).
I have a couple of questions:
1. How should I transport a custom FPM application from one portal to other portal? (The problem that I see is that, if I create an FPM application or an FPM View in any folder in the PCD through the Self Service Administrator role, the content of the folder is only visible if I am in this role. Can we create a transport package similar to other PCD content for transporting an FPM application/ FPM view?)
2. Do I need to configure the AppIntegrator service in other portals as well ? (In theory, I will not be using Self Service Administrator role in other portals. I will just transport the content created in development portal to test and prod portals)

Salome,
Just create a PCD transport package the same as you normally would for iViews etc, but include your custom FPM applications instead.
I've done this many times before and it works perfectly.
